Miniature beef and caramelized onion tartlets are a delightful appetizer that combines rich flavors with elegant presentation. Perfect for parties or sophisticated gatherings, these tartlets are both easy to make and visually appealing.

Ingredients Needed

  • 1 sheet of puff pastry, thawed
  • 200 grams of ground beef
  • 1 large onion, thinly sliced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on thyme
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 egg, beaten (for egg wash)
  • Optional: grated cheese or herbs for garnish

Preparation Steps

Start by preheating your oven to 200°C (390°F). Roll out the puff pastry on a lightly floured surface and cut into small circles using a cookie cutter or a glass. Place these circles into a muffin tin lined with parchment paper.

Next, prepare the caramelized onions.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add the sliced onions, thyme, salt, and pepper. Cook slowly, stirring occasionally, until the onions are golden brown and sweet, about 20-25 minutes.

Meanwhile, cook the ground beef in a separate skillet until browned. Season with salt and pepper. Once cooked, set aside.

Distribute the cooked beef evenly among the pastry shells, then top with a spoonful of caramelized onions. Brush the edges of the pastry with beaten egg to give a golden finish.

Bake in the preheated oven for 15-20 minutes or until the pastry is golden and crisp. Remove from the oven and allow to cool slightly before serving.

Serving Suggestions

Garnish the tartlets with fresh herbs or a sprinkle of grated cheese. Serve warm or at room temperature for an elegant appetizer that impresses guests with its flavor and presentation.

Tips for Success

  • Use high-quality puff pastry for best texture.
  • Cook the onions slowly to develop deep caramelization.
  • Prepare the tartlets ahead of time and reheat briefly before serving.
  • Customize with additional toppings like chopped herbs or a drizzle of balsamic glaze.
